Your tasks as a Tool Crib Technician may include, among others:

  • Perform the issuing and receipt of tools, which encompasses activities in both the Tool Crib and outside tool stores
  • Perform tool inspections to ensure their functionality and compliance with safety standards
  • Loan tools in\out control system to maintain accurate records
  • Add to database tooling information
  • Regularly updating the database with pertinent tooling information to ensure comprehensive and up-to-date records
  • Move tools for loan to Tool Crib
  • Support lifting inspections (Tool Crib tools)
  • Assign tool numbers
  • Control of storage and locations for maintaining an organized tool inventory
  • Tool Kit control
  • Generate statistics for unavailable tools to provide insights into tool availability and usage patterns

About Lufthansa Technik Puerto Rico LLC.

Lufthansa Technik Puerto Rico is a 5 bay maintenance facility specialized in the maintenance, repair and overhaul (MRO) of the Airbus A320 family aircraft. We are strategically located in Aguadilla, Puerto Rico where we provide support for customers from both North and South America. Our success is built on our employees who are fundamental to our organization by performing a world-class service. Lufthansa Technik Puerto Rico was founded in 2014 and is a fully owned company of the Lufthansa Technik Group - the world's leading provider of maintenance, repair and overhaul services as well as modifications to the civil aviation industry. With tailor-made maintenance programs and advanced repair techniques, we ensure the reliability and availability of our customers' aircraft fleets. We are independent of aircraft manufacturers and licensed internationally as a repair, manufacturing and development organization. With more than 26,000 employees and over 30 international subsidiaries, the Lufthansa Technik Group offers a full range of services in the fields of maintenance, overhaul, component support, engines, landing gears, VIP services, innovation and digital fleet solutions to around 800 customers worldwide.
